Connect an external monitor to the laptop (TV- HDMI) and check if the display is OK.
''If it is'' then there's a backlight problem with the laptop's display.
This could be due to a problem on the motherboard, a faulty video cable/cable connection between the motherboard and the display panel or perhaps it is a faulty LCD panel.

On p.35 it details the procedure to remove the display assembly.
+
+
This is useful in several ways as it will allow you to check the eDP cable (video cable) connection on the motherboard to make sure that it is secure.
+
+
It will also allow you to test for the backlight power on eDP connector pins 17, 18 & 19.

If the eDP cable connection seems secure and the backlight power is on the pins then it is in the cable or the LCD screen but looking at the service manual it appears that the display assembly is a complete module i.e. cable, LCD panel, lid cover etc. as it doesn't show how to disassemble it further.
